Windows Embedded 8 Released

On March 20, 2013,Microsoft announced the general availability of the Windows Embedded 8 familyof operating systems. In addition to extending Windows 8 technologies withadditional features to help OEM device makers to deliver robust and secureddevice, the Windows Embedded 8 family includes efficient tools and resources thatenable OEMs to rapidly build new generation of intelligent devices with thecapabilities to capture, analyze and act on valuable data across their organization’sIT infrastructures, and capitalizing on the Internet-of-Things business trends.

Why should I use an Embedded Operating System on an Embedded Device?

This is a good question when it comes from people with no experience on embedded devices and a very bad one when you hear it coming from people that work on embedded devices. “I’m using a PC inside my embedded device, so I can use Windows as I use it on my PC” this is usually a statement made by people who actually design bad embedded devices. And those devices are not bad because they use a PC-based hardware (using a PC may be a good solution for some kind of devices where developing a custom board is too expensive and does not provide any real advantage in terms of cost), not because they use Windows. It’s because they use a Windows version designed for PCs, and so they behave like a PC and not like an embedded device! A PC has always a user taking care of it (or calling for help when something goes wrong beyond his recovery capabilities!), an embedded device must run unattended. Windows Embedded Compact 7 - Getting Started Minimize

The Windows Embedded Compact 7 (Compact 7) getting started series is created to provide simple and easy to follow information to help academic, hobbyist and commercial developers to learn and engage in Compact 7 development.

This is a series of 9 articles, with additional supplements, that cover the following subjects:

  • Development environment
  • OS design
  • Managed code application
  • Native code application
  • Silverlight for Windows Embedded application
  • SQL Compact database application
  • Debug and remote tools
